Exhibition of Artworks by Xu Beihong, Zhou Lingzhao and Dai Ze

Introduction

Exhibition of Artworks by Xu Beihong, Zhou Lingzhao and Dai Ze

Xu Beihong, the first President of China Central Academy of Fine Arts(CAFA), is a master of modern painting and art and alsoan art educator. Zhou Lingzhao and Dai Ze were both invited by Xu Beihong to teach at the CAFA, and they both adhere to the direction of art education and creation initiated by Xu Beihong. As pioneers of Chinese art in the 20th century and the founders of Chinese modern art education, the three artists have made historic contributions to the establishment of the Chinese modern art education system.

Artist introduction

Xu Beihong, born in Yixing, Jiangsu Province, is a master of modern painting and art and an art educator. He studied in France and has long been engaged in art education after his return. He has successfully taught in the Painting Research Association of the Peking University, National Central University, School of art, Peking University, and Peking National Art Academy.
Xu Beihong was good at both calligraphy and painting and is renowned in painting horses. He puts forward “the Chinese Painting Improvement Theory”, emphasizing that the Chinese art should reform and innovate. Besides, he cultivated a galaxy of talents and backbones for art creation and art education. This has made historic contributions to the founding of the Chinese modern art education system. He is undoubtedly the pioneer of Chinese art in the 20th century and the founder of Chinese modern art education.
Zhou Lingzhao, born in Pingjiang, Hunan Province,  is a professor in Central Academy of Fine Arts and consultant of the Chinese Mural Academy. He has successively served as the Director of National Painting Studio, Mural Department, CAFA, art design consultant of China Stamp Printing Bureau, Director of Chinese Artists Association, President of the Chinese Gouache Institute of the Chinese Artists Association, and etc.
He has participated in the design of National Emblem of the People's Republic of China, Emblem of the CPPCC, Flag of the Young Pioneers and etc. He painted the portrait of Chairman Mao on the Tiananmen Gate-tower in the founding ceremony of PRC. He also designed the Flag of the Communist Youth League, three medals of the Chinese People's Liberation Army, and was in charge of the overall art design of the 2nd, 3rd, and 4th sets of RMB. He is an artist who is constantly exploring and attempting to use a variety of painting mediums while sticking to the national and traditional culture and taking beautiful sceneries and people as his life-long artist theme.
Dai Ze, born in Yunyang, Sichuan Province, is a professor in Central Academy of Fine Arts and consultant of the Chinese Mural Academy. In 1942, he was admitted to the Art Department, National Central University and learnt from Xu Beihong and Chen Zhifo, etc. Then at the invitation of Xu Beihong, he went to teach in Peking National Art Academy. In 1949, he assisted Xu Beihong to prepare and establish the Central Academy of Fine Arts and in 1985 he assisted Mrs. Liao Jingwen to open the Xu Beihong Studio and took charge of teaching. 
During decades of teaching, he has cultivated a large number of talents such as Jin Shangyi, Wang Jindong and so on. His paintings, including “Group Meetings of Peasants”, “ Sign for Peace” are excellent realistic works in the new China. Dai Ze, as one the founders of the art education in the new China, has made significant contributions to art creation and education. He is a vital participant and witness in the development of modern art.
